What are the different types of consensus protocols used in the cryptocurrency industry?

- Dhanish M KJan 30, 2023 · 2 years agoSure! In the cryptocurrency industry, there are several types of consensus protocols used to validate transactions and maintain the integrity of the blockchain. Some of the most common ones include Proof of Work (PoW), Proof of Stake (PoS), Delegated Proof of Stake (DPoS), and Practical Byzantine Fault Tolerance (PBFT). Each protocol has its own unique way of achieving consensus and preventing double-spending. For example, PoW requires miners to solve complex mathematical puzzles to validate transactions, while PoS relies on participants holding a certain amount of cryptocurrency to validate transactions. DPoS introduces a voting system where token holders elect a limited number of delegates to validate transactions. PBFT is a consensus algorithm that focuses on achieving consensus in a distributed system even in the presence of faulty nodes. These consensus protocols play a crucial role in ensuring the security and decentralization of cryptocurrencies.
- Edoardo RossiNov 21, 2020 · 5 years agoConsensus protocols are like the rules of the game in the cryptocurrency industry. They determine how transactions are validated and added to the blockchain. Without consensus, there would be chaos and no trust in the system. Proof of Work is the most well-known consensus protocol, used by Bitcoin and many other cryptocurrencies. It involves miners competing to solve complex mathematical puzzles to validate transactions. Proof of Stake, on the other hand, relies on participants holding a certain amount of cryptocurrency to validate transactions. This eliminates the need for energy-intensive mining. Delegated Proof of Stake introduces a voting system where token holders elect a limited number of delegates to validate transactions. This allows for faster transaction confirmations. Practical Byzantine Fault Tolerance is a consensus algorithm that focuses on achieving consensus in a distributed system even in the presence of faulty nodes. These different consensus protocols offer various trade-offs in terms of security, scalability, and energy efficiency.
